MAAP was born in a city with an unhealthy obsession with sport, style and coffee. Today, we continue to blur the space between performance, aesthetics and culture - creating technical apparel for riders who demand the highest standard of product experience.MAAP is looking for a Lead Sales Administration Coordinator to join our global Sales team.This is a hands-on role with two key areas of responsibility: owning Sales Administration and Coordination across APAC and the Americas, while helping drive consistency, communication and best practice across our global Sales Administration function.Reporting to the VP Sales, you’ll work closely with Sales Administration Coordinators across the UK, US and Australia, supporting a seamless wholesale customer experience across regions.The RoleYou’ll take direct responsibility for Sales Coordination across APAC and the Americas, supporting our Sales teams and wholesale partners across the full customer journey.Your responsibilities will include:Managing wholesale customer administration across APAC and the Americas, including orders, invoicing, credit notes, logistics, inventory, warranties and samplesCoordinating Indent, Pre-Order and B2B activity across wholesale accountsSupporting Sales teams with order management, customer administration and key commercial initiativesKeeping customers informed on launches, availability, delivery timelines and implementation plansBuilding strong, long-term relationships with wholesale partnersActing as an escalation point for complex customer and Sales Administration mattersSharing customer feedback, market insights and opportunities with the VP Sales and wider businessAlongside your regional responsibilities, you’ll help strengthen the way our global Sales Administration team works together by:Providing guidance on processes, systems and best practiceSupporting team members with more complex customer or operational mattersDriving consistent standards of customer service and administration across regionsImproving communication and handover across time zonesIdentifying opportunities to improve workflows, workload distribution and efficiencyMaintaining clear processes, documentation and team resourcesSupporting the onboarding and development of new Sales Administration CoordinatorsAbout YouYou’ll be highly organised, commercially minded and comfortable operating across multiple markets, stakeholders and time zones.We’re looking for someone who brings:Strong experience in sales administration, sales operations, wholesale coordination or a similar commercial support roleExperience supporting wholesale customers and managing end-to-end order administrationExcellent attention to detail and a high level of accuracyStrong customer service and stakeholder management skillsConfidence navigating competing priorities in a fast-moving environmentAn ability to identify process improvements and create greater consistency across teamsStrong systems capability, including CRM and order-management platforms (Netsuite, NuOrder)A collaborative working style and the confidence to provide guidance and support to colleagues across regionsExperience within apparel, retail, wholesale or a global consumer brand environment would be highly regarded.If you’re an experienced Sales Administration or Wholesale Operations professional looking to take on broader global responsibility while remaining close to customers and the commercial detail, we’d love to hear from you.
